This morning, I am delivering the presentation, 21st Century Genealogy: Taking Advantage of Social Media for Your Research, at the British Isles Family History Society of Greater Ottawa’s 21st annual conference.
I hope to whet the audience’s appetite to explore social media for family history research.
During the presentation, I will talk about blogs, Facebook, YouTube, Twitter, and Pinterest and how they can help us become better genealogists.
One of the resources I will share is my newly updated Facebook for Canadian Genealogy list that is available here — Facebook for Canadian Genealogy_September 2015.
In Facebook groups and pages, new and experienced genealogists share resources and tips and learn from each other by posting questions and comments.
To be honest, until I discovered Facebook genealogy groups, I thought Facebook was just a place where people looked at photos of cats. Now, I’m a convert.
